Boeing is the world's largest aerospace company, providing commercial airplanes, defense, space and security systems, and global services. An American multinational corporation, Boeing designs, manufactures, and sells airplanes, rotorcraft, rockets, satellites, telecommunications equipment, and missiles globally.
